Ingredients:
- 1 pound ground beef substitute
- 0.67 pounds cauliflower
- 0.67 cups cheddar cheese
- 0.33 teaspoons garlic salt
- Salt and pepper, to taste
Directions:
Steam or boil cauliflower until soft. While cauliflower is cooking, cook “beef” as outlitned in recipe linked above. Add cauliflower, seasonings and cheese. Mix until cheese is melted. See freezing directions.
Freezing Directions:
AFTER cooked, place in gallon freezer bag and freeze. To serve: Thaw. Heat in microwave 1 minute.
Servings: 4
